HANDY TIPS TO PREPARE FOR A POSSIBLE POWER CUT
  1. locate all your candles and battery operated torch lights and place them in an easily accessible position.
  2. Plug in your phone and have it charging before your power cuts.
  3. Install a torchlight app on your phone.
  4. Boil a kettle and fill a few flasks of hot water, again leaving them in easily accessible places.
  5. Fill any hot water bottles you have in your home.
  6. Make some sandwiches (Turkey is a good choice this time of year) wrap them in tinfoil, they may come in handy later.
  7. Freeze a few plastic bags of water into ice. If the power cuts later these will help keep your fridge and freezer colder until power is restored.
  8. Check on an elderly or needy friend or relative.
  9. Make sure any pets or animals you have are safe also.
  10. If you have any portable chargers, make sure they are fully charged.

Again all of this is only precautionary advice, you may not suffer any power loss, but you can be sure that other people will.
